Output e3043b3266e947df0bbf28cf37e792fd538c09f4bde9df40b0b259e41298434b:0

value
502409
script pubkey
OP_0 OP_PUSHBYTES_20 96c0e1108e886d27f9dbccbf6a57e2c3694c4224
address
bc1qjmqwzyyw3pkj07wmejlk54lzcd55cs3yk4p69s
transaction
e3043b3266e947df0bbf28cf37e792fd538c09f4bde9df40b0b259e41298434b